Output 074b089658e183e183241a187a8c7a4c59e9b7486ccf1ac520745e627023b907:0

value
168509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1dde648c6e039dde165a3622bfa3374726a099c OP_EQUAL
address
3NHHnZEGeDqJChkiYfxjssWSLRgC4dgZyB
transaction
074b089658e183e183241a187a8c7a4c59e9b7486ccf1ac520745e627023b907
confirmations
454555
spent
true